What is Creatine and How Does It Work?

Creatine is a naturally occurring compound found in muscle cells. As a supplement, it increases the availability of ATP (adenosine triphosphate), which is the primary energy carrier in the body. This leads to improved performance during high-intensity exercise. Creatine also helps in muscle recovery and growth.

Types of Creatine Supplements

There are several forms of creatine available, but creatine monohydrate is the most widely studied and commonly used. Other forms include creatine hydrochloride (HCL), creatine ethyl ester, and buffered creatine.

Creatine Monohydrate

Creatine monohydrate is the most popular and cost-effective form. It has been extensively researched and proven to be safe and effective for most individuals.

Creatine HCL

Creatine HCL is more soluble in water, which some claim leads to better absorption and fewer side effects like bloating. However, more research is needed to confirm these benefits definitively.

How to Use Creatine

The typical creatine dosage involves a loading phase followed by a maintenance phase.

Loading Phase

Take 20 grams of creatine per day, divided into four doses, for 5-7 days.

Maintenance Phase

Take 3-5 grams of creatine per day to maintain muscle creatine stores.

Note: It's essential to stay hydrated when taking creatine to maximize its benefits and prevent potential side effects.

Potential Side Effects

Creatine is generally safe for most people, but some may experience mild side effects such as:

  • Water Retention
  • Bloating
  • Digestive Issues
